Golden State Serial Killer Prosecutor Launches Bid for Superior Court Judge Seat

A former prosecutor of the Golden State Killer case in California, will be running for the position of Superior Court Judge.

The prosecutor, who was instrumental in the conviction of the Golden State Killer, has announced their candidacy for the position of Superior Court Judge. This move comes after their successful prosecution of the infamous serial killer, who terrorized California in the 1970s and 1980s.

The Golden State Killer, also known as the East Area Rapist, was responsible for at least 13 murders and more than 50 rapes. The prosecutor’s work on this case earned them recognition and praise for their dedication and commitment to seeking justice for the victims and their families.
